A popular alternative to real fireplaces is the electric fireplace. This elegant feature is easily installed and is a great feature to add to your home's decor. Electric fireplaces use mirrors and LED lights to create the illusion of flames, creating a realistic look. Certain models employ water vapor in addition to create a more realistic smoke effect. These effects can be used to create a feeling of warmth and comfort in any space.

It is essential to study the instructions to ensure safe and correct installation prior to installing an electric fire. The guidelines will offer specific guidelines for framing, mounting and securing, as well as clearances. It is recommended to consult an experienced carpenter in the installation process. However, it is possible to do most of the work yourself if you have some basic DIY skills.

The first step in putting in an electric fireplace is to select the ideal location. It will be determined by your desired dimensions as well as the space you have available in your home. Make sure the fireplace can fit within the area you choose and not block any other features or furnishings. Pay attention to the clearance requirements, which differ from model to model.

After you have selected the best location for your fireplace it's time to start preparing the walls. You can either put up the fireplace with an ordinary bracket or frame it and build the fireplace in the walls for a more classic style. In either case, it is recommended to make use of a stud-finder in order to make sure that the frame is built to last.

Once the installation is completed It is recommended to test the fireplace to be sure that it functions correctly. Connect it and test the heat and flame effects. It is also important to keep combustible materials like pillows, blankets paper, clothing, and papers at least 3 feet away from the front of the fireplace and 1.5 feet from its sides.

Once the electric fireplace is installed, it is time to relax! You can start it with the remote control or manually by pressing the buttons. You can also use the decorative front cover to conceal the power cord for an elegant appearance.

Realistic looking

A fireplace that is electric must be able to replicate the look and feel of an actual fire so that it can provide the same atmosphere as a burning wood log. It must also provide enough heat to keep you 849827.xyz comfortable. The best way to achieve this is to create an authentic flame effect using an log and ember bed made of materials that appear to burn. These kinds of materials are usually covered with LEDs to enhance the realism of the flames. Some models also have a smoke effect, which can be enhanced by water vapor or projection to give it an authentic look.

The flame effect is created by the majority of electric fireplaces that use mechanical technology. This includes LED screens and the blower which is able to move air to simulate flames. Although they're a step up from older technology, they're still unable to capture the photorealism of real flames. Many customers prefer the Dimplex Opti-Myst because it has superior flame effects that are nearly indistinguishable to a real wood-burning fireplace. It is important to note, however, that this type of fireplace requires plumbing and frequent refilling of the water tank. It is recommended to use distilled or filtered water to stop the tiny holes in the fogger from becoming clogged with minerals and other hard water deposits.

The latest models of electric fireplaces make use of advanced holographic technology to create realistic flame effects. They are captivating, and can fool even skeptical people to believe they are real. They can also use various flame colors and effects that suit your mood. They usually contain ambient sound effects and crackling sounds, in addition to the beautiful images.

Electric fireplaces that are the most realistic offer a variety of flame effects. They include traditional logs, as well as contemporary glass. Some electric fireplaces have numerous layers of fake embers as well as rocks and embers to enhance the appearance. They're often coupled with a built-in heater which provides additional warmth. Some models even come with a media compartment for a TV.

Easy to clean

An electric fireplace stove is a wonderful addition to any home. It adds a touch of warmth to any room and can serve as backdrop for family gatherings and holiday parties. However, just like other types of fireplaces, it requires a certain amount of maintenance. Fortunately, cleaning an electric fire is easy and takes little time.

Before you begin cleaning the appliance, it's essential to turn the power off and let it cool. Remove any decorative elements to prevent check here getting scratched or stained. After the fire is turned off make use of a clean rag to wipe the fireplace's surfaces and clean any dust. You can also get rid of any fingerprints or smudges from the glass surfaces of your electric fireplace.

You must regularly clean your electric fireplace to keep it looking fresh. This will help to keep it from becoming old-fashioned and dull. It can also help prolong its life. Regular cleaning of your fireplace ensures that all of its components work properly.

Before cleaning your electric fireplace, ensure that you unplug it and turn off the power. This will ensure that you don't risk damaging any of its internal components. After you've completed this, you can begin cleaning it. Begin by wiping the interior of the fireplace using a dry rag. This will remove any dust that may have accumulated over time, and can cause problems with the heating of your fireplace.

Next Clean the inlet and outlets vents located at the base of the fireplace. These are usually located on the front and back of the fireplace. It is essential to inspect them frequently since they could check here become blocked by dust or other particles and cause the heater not to work properly.

You should also wipe down the ember bed as well as the heat outlets and inlets, as well as the glass. After you've cleaned each of these areas, you can replace the front glass panel according to the instructions in your manual.
